The picture of Dublin, for 1811; being a description of the city, and a correct guide to all the public establishments, curiosities, amusements, exhibitions, and remarkable objects, in and near the city of Dublin. With a map of Dublin in the year 1610; alarge mapfor the present year, and several views. On the same principle as the picture of London..
